在当今数据驱动的世界中,企业面临着从海量数据中提取有价值信息的挑战。数据清洗技术成为提高数据利用率的关键一步。不仅能够清除冗余数据,提升数据质量,还能显著增强数据的使用价值。然而,许多组织在实施数据清洗时,常常感到无从下手或力不从心。这篇文章将深入探讨数据清洗技术如何在实践中提高数据利用率,揭示其背后的价值和优势。

🌟一、数据清洗的重要性与挑战
数据清洗不仅仅是数据处理的一个环节,它直接关系到数据分析结果的准确性和可靠性。在数据清洗过程中,企业通常会遇到以下几个挑战:
1. 数据冗余的识别与清除
在数据源丰富的现代环境中,数据冗余是企业常见的问题。重复的数据不仅增加了存储成本,还可能导致分析结果的偏差。例如,客户信息在不同的数据库中重复存储,会导致在分析客户行为时产生误导性的结论。
为了有效地识别和清除冗余数据,企业需要:
- 采用强大的数据匹配算法,识别重复的数据条目。
- 利用自动化工具,减少人工干预,提升清洗效率。
- 定期更新和维护数据清洗策略,以应对不断变化的数据环境。
FineDataLink在这方面提供了强大的支持,其低代码平台可以帮助企业轻松设置数据清洗规则,实现实时的冗余数据清理。 FineDataLink体验Demo
2. 数据一致性与准确性
数据一致性是指在不同数据库或系统中,数据必须保持相同的内容和格式。数据不一致会导致分析和决策的失误。例如,若一个客户的地址在不同系统中不一致,会影响物流和客户服务的效率。
提升数据一致性的方法包括:
- 采用标准化的数据录入格式,避免因格式不统一导致的错误。
- 实施数据同步策略,确保在各个系统中数据的一致性。
- 定期进行数据验证,识别并纠正数据的不一致。
3. 数据清洗工具的选择
选择合适的数据清洗工具至关重要。工具的性能、易用性和功能性直接影响清洗过程的效率和效果。
数据清洗工具应具备以下特性:
- 支持多种数据源和格式的接入。
- 提供可视化的清洗规则配置界面,简化操作。
- 具备强大且灵活的清洗能力,能够处理复杂的数据清洗场景。
工具名称 | 主要功能 | 优势 |
---|---|---|
FineDataLink | 实时数据同步、清洗 | 低代码、高效实用 |
OpenRefine | 数据转换与清洗 | 开源、灵活 |
Trifacta | 数据准备与清洗 | 直观的用户界面 |
在选择工具时,FineDataLink凭借其低代码和高效实用的特点,成为众多企业的首选。
🔍二、数据清洗的流程与实践
数据清洗是一个系统化的过程,涉及多个步骤和策略。有效的数据清洗流程确保数据的完整性和准确性。
1. 数据收集与理解
数据清洗的第一步是收集和理解数据。这一阶段的目标是明确数据的来源、类型和质量。企业需要对数据的属性进行全面评估,以制定适合的清洗策略。
进行数据收集与理解的步骤包括:
- 确定数据来源:识别所有数据源,确保数据的完整收集。
- 评估数据质量:检查数据的准确性、完整性和一致性。
- 理解数据结构:分析数据的格式、类型和关系。
有效的数据收集与理解能够为后续的清洗步骤提供坚实的基础。
2. 数据清洗策略的制定
制定数据清洗策略是确保清洗效果的关键。企业需要根据特定的数据问题,选择合适的清洗方法和工具。
常见的数据清洗策略包括:
- 去除重复数据:利用算法识别和删除重复条目。
- 修正格式错误:统一数据格式,确保一致性。
- 补全缺失数据:填补数据缺失,提升数据完整性。
在制定策略时,企业应充分考虑数据的特性和业务需求。
3. 数据清洗的执行与验证
在制定了合适的策略后,企业需要执行数据清洗,并验证清洗效果。清洗的执行可以通过自动化工具完成,而验证则需要结合业务逻辑进行检测。
执行与验证的步骤包括:
- 执行清洗任务:利用工具自动执行清洗规则。
- 进行数据验证:检查清洗后的数据是否符合预期。
- 反馈与调整:根据验证结果,优化清洗策略。
通过有效的执行与验证,企业可以确保数据清洗的质量和效率。
📈三、数据清洗对数据利用率的提升
数据清洗不仅能够提高数据质量,还能显著提升数据的利用率。清洁的数据能够更好地支持企业的决策和业务增长。
1. 提升数据分析的准确性
数据分析的准确性直接依赖于数据的质量。通过数据清洗,企业可以去除不准确和不一致的数据,从而提高分析结果的可靠性。
数据清洗对分析准确性的影响包括:
- 消除噪声数据:去除无关或错误的数据,聚焦于有价值的信息。
- 提高数据一致性:确保数据的一致性,增强分析的连贯性。
- 优化数据结构:简化数据结构,提高分析效率。
2. 增强数据驱动的决策能力
高质量的数据是数据驱动决策的基础。通过数据清洗,企业能够更准确地识别趋势和模式,从而做出更明智的决策。
数据清洗对决策能力的贡献包括:
- 提升预测准确性:利用清洁的数据进行预测,提高预测的精度。
- 支持实时决策:通过实时数据清洗,提供最新的数据支持。
- 增强业务洞察:揭示隐藏的模式和关系,提升业务洞察力。
3. 提高数据资源的利用效率
数据清洗能够减少数据的冗余和无效占用,提升数据资源的利用效率。企业可以将更多的资源投入到增值活动中。
提高数据利用效率的表现包括:
- 降低存储成本:去除冗余数据,减少存储需求。
- 提升数据处理速度:优化数据结构,提升处理效率。
- 增强数据共享能力:通过清洁数据,促进不同部门间的数据共享。
这些提升能够为企业带来显著的竞争优势。
📚结尾:总结与展望
数据清洗技术是提升数据利用率的核心手段。通过清除冗余数据和优化数据结构,企业能够显著提高数据分析的准确性和决策的有效性。选择合适的工具,如FineDataLink,可以大大简化数据清洗的流程,增强数据治理的能力。
引用文献:
- 《数据科学与大数据技术》, 某出版社, 2022.
- 《数据治理:从战略到执行》, 某出版社, 2021.
- 《大数据时代的企业数字化转型》, 某出版社, 2023.
通过不断优化数据清洗策略,企业可以在信息时代中保持竞争力,实现更大的商业成功。
本文相关FAQs
🤔 数据清洗究竟是什么?如何理解它对数据利用率的重要性?
老板总是强调数据要“干净”,但到底什么是数据清洗?我平时处理的数据里,很多字段看着没用,能不能简单地删掉?有没有大佬能科普一下数据清洗的基本概念,以及它在提升数据利用率方面的作用?

数据清洗是数据处理过程中一个非常重要的环节。简单来说,它就是通过一系列的方法和工具对原始数据进行修正、删除和验证,从而提升数据的准确性和一致性。这不仅仅是为了让数据看起来更整洁,更重要的是提高数据的实际利用价值。

背景知识:在企业数据处理中,数据清洗的重要性往往被低估。事实上,数据清洗是数据分析、数据挖掘以及数据可视化的基础。无论是SQL数据库、NoSQL数据库,还是大数据平台如Hadoop和Spark,数据清洗都扮演着关键角色。
实际场景:设想一下,你是一家零售公司的数据分析师,每天都在处理成千上万笔交易数据。你发现有很多记录的格式不一致,有些字段是空的,有些字段的数据格式不对,比如日期格式混乱。这时候,数据清洗就是你最好的帮手。通过清洗,你可以统一日期格式、填补缺失数据、删除重复记录,从而大大提升数据的准确性。
难点突破:尽管数据清洗听起来很简单,但实际操作中常常遇到诸多挑战。例如,如何识别和处理重复数据?如何处理缺失值?如何在不丢失重要信息的情况下删除冗余数据?这些问题需要结合具体的业务场景和数据特点来处理。
方法建议:数据清洗的方法多种多样,常用的有:
- 去重:使用唯一标识符(如ID)来识别并删除重复数据。
- 填补缺失值:可以通过均值、中位数、众数等方法来填补缺失值。
- 格式规范化:统一数据格式,如日期、货币单位等。
- 异常值检测:识别并处理数据中的异常值,通常使用统计学方法。
清洗后的数据不仅更准确,还能提高数据分析的效率和效果。良好的数据清洗流程是数据分析成功的基石。
🔄 如何有效地清除数据中的冗余信息?
我在处理数据时,经常发现好多重复的信息,不仅占用存储空间,还影响分析结果。有没有什么简便的方法可以识别和删除这些冗余数据?特别是那种轻松上手的技巧,适合我们这种“手动党”?
冗余数据是数据处理中一个常见的问题,它不仅浪费存储资源,还会干扰数据分析的准确性。有效地清除冗余信息需要结合自动化工具和手动识别的方法。
背景知识:冗余数据通常是由于多次数据采集、数据迁移或系统集成不当造成的。它可能表现为重复的记录、相似的数据条目,甚至是完全相同但存储在不同数据库中的数据。
实际场景:假设你是一家电商平台的数据管理员,数据库中存储了大量用户的购物记录。由于系统升级和数据迁移,导致同一用户的多次购物记录在不同表中重复出现。长此以往,不仅存储资源被浪费,数据分析的结果也会受到影响。
难点突破:识别冗余数据并不总是容易的。有时候,冗余数据并不会直接显示为完全相同的记录,而是存在细微的差异,比如日期格式不同、大小写不同等。此外,在清除冗余数据时,如何确保数据的完整性和一致性也是一大挑战。
方法建议:
- 数据库去重功能:大多数数据库管理系统如MySQL、PostgreSQL都提供了去重功能,可以使用
DISTINCT
关键字来去除重复记录。
- 数据除重工具:市场上有很多数据清洗工具,如OpenRefine、Trifacta等,这些工具可以自动识别和清除冗余数据,适合处理大规模数据集。
- 自定义脚本:如果你有编程基础,可以编写脚本(如Python、R),使用算法来识别和删除冗余数据。Python的Pandas库提供了强大的数据处理能力,可以轻松实现数据去重。
- FineDataLink体验Demo:作为企业级数据集成平台, FineDataLink 可以帮助企业实现高效的数据清洗和治理,特别适合大数据场景下的实时数据处理。
通过有效地清除冗余数据,企业可以降低存储成本,提高数据分析的准确性和实用性。这不仅能提升数据利用率,还能为企业决策提供更可靠的支持。
📊 如何通过数据清洗技术提高数据的实际使用价值?
在数据清洗之后,接下来该怎么利用这些“干净”数据来提升业务价值呢?有没有什么具体的策略或方法,能帮助我们将清洗过的数据转化为实实在在的商业价值?
数据清洗后的数据更为精准和一致,但如何将这些数据转化为实际的业务价值,是很多企业面临的挑战。提升数据的使用价值不仅需要技术手段,还需要商业战略的支持。
背景知识:数据清洗后的数据能为企业提供更准确的分析基础,使得预测模型更为可靠,策略制定更为精准。清洗后的数据可以应用于市场分析、用户画像、精准营销等多个领域。
实际场景:假如你是一家快速消费品公司的数据分析师,经过清洗的消费者购买数据,可以帮助团队更好地理解消费者行为,识别购买模式,从而优化库存管理和营销策略。
难点突破:如何将清洗后的数据应用于实际场景,进而提升业务价值,是企业面临的难题。数据的价值不仅在于它的准确性,更在于如何应用这些数据来驱动业务增长。
方法建议:
- 数据驱动决策:通过清洗后的数据,企业可以识别出高价值客户群体,并针对这些客户制定个性化的营销策略,提高客户满意度和忠诚度。
- 业务流程优化:使用干净的数据分析,企业可以识别出业务流程中的瓶颈,进而进行改进。例如,通过分析清洗后的生产数据,可以优化生产计划,减少资源浪费。
- 预测分析:利用清洗后的数据,企业可以构建更精准的预测模型,帮助企业在市场需求预测、库存管理、客户需求预测等方面做出更好的决策。
- FineDataLink体验Demo:为了更好地实现数据的价值转化, FineDataLink 提供了一站式的数据治理和分析平台,帮助企业从数据采集、清洗到分析的一体化解决方案。
通过合理地应用数据清洗技术,企业不仅能提高数据的利用率,还能挖掘出数据背后的商业价值。这对于企业的长期发展和竞争力提升都是至关重要的。